Selecting the Right Elements for Your Tailored Lip Balm

When making a bespoke lip balm, selecting the ideal ingredients is crucial for achieving the desired texture and functionality. Base oils like coconut, sweet almond, or jojoba offer moisture and smoothness. Beeswax or natural waxes act as thickening agents, building a defensive layer while keeping the balm stable.

Additionally, introducing butters such as shea or cocoa helps hydration and softness. To incorporate nourishment, essential oils and natural extracts might be combined, offering potential benefits like soothing or revitalizing properties.

It is also crucial to consider the ratio of ingredients; too much wax can cause a stiff balm, while too much oil may produce a runny texture. Ultimately, thoughtful selection of ingredients not only affects the lip balm’s texture but also its overall appeal and effectiveness, making it essential for anyone looking to create a distinctive product.

Seasonal Flavor Guides

Exploring seasonal flavors adds fresh excitement to personalized lip balm creations. Each time of year offers unique ingredients that can spark delightful combinations. In spring, blend floral scents like lavender with citrusy elements such as lemon or grapefruit. Summer brings tropical flavors, pairing coconut with pineapple for a revitalizing taste. Autumn calls for warmth, combining pumpkin spice with vanilla or caramel to evoke cozy feelings. Winter is celebrated with minty mixes, like peppermint and chocolate, providing a festive touch. Each flavor not only enhances the sensory experience but also connects users to seasonal moods, making custom lip balms more than a product—they become a celebration of the year’s changing flavors.

How long can DIY lip balm stay effective?

Homemade lip balm usually endures for six to twelve months if stored in a fresh, dark place. Proper hygiene during preparation combined with organic additives can prolong shelf life, guaranteeing consistency and safety for use.
